Hey guys here is the #'s from my third run down the 1/4 mile. This was my best run of the day. Any help would be apprecaited.

Altitude was 5800 Feet
Temp 84
Relative Humidity 100
Barometer 23.80

R/T .426 - Not my best R/T my best was .038
60' 2.459
330' 6.808
1/8 10.335
mph 69.01
1000 13.392
1/4 15.953
mph 88.85


By the way I have a stock 95 Cobra. Well I have a CAI but that doesn't really count.

were u dumping the clutch im guessing ?? yeah, thats bad. lol u need to find that "sweet spot". start @ 1500. slipping the clutch a lil bit til u get a tiny chirp from the tires. thats it. or, like i said, just get some Nitto or BFG drag radials.

your 60' is killing you. 2500 rpm isn't that bad to launch at. tryin slippin the clutch a little more.
also the 5800 altitude is goin to hurt your top end.
DR's will help, but i'm an advocate of learnign with what you got before modding again
